United Arab Emirates Launches New Rules for Low-Voltage Equipment
We would like to remind our subscribers that the following audio/video and IT/office equipment is subject to Low Voltage Equipment (LVE) Regulations in the United Arab Emirates:
Non-professional stand-alone audio products:
Radio
Record players
Disc players
MP3 players
Speaker systems
Amplifiers
Soundbars (Bluetooth or otherwise)
Other audio products
Non-professional stand-alone video playing and recording systems:
VCD, DVD, Blu-ray players
Digital still and video cameras
Game consoles
Projectors
Videoke/Karaoke multimedia systems
TV decoders and set-top boxes
Consumer series desktops and laptop computers, all-in-one PCs
Tablets and palm pilots
Desktop/computer monitors
Printers/scanners (i.e. inkjet, laser, etc.) including office printers, multi-function printers (MFP), label printers, portable or stand-alone
Non-professional routers, repeaters
Microphones
Touch drawing pads
Landline phones (corded/cordless)
External hard drives supplied with an external power supply (i.e. NAS – Network-attached storage, etc.)
All the above-mentioned equipment should meet the requirements of IEC 62368-1.
Currently, there are two valid versions of this standard: IEC 62368:2014 (2nd Edition) and IEC 62368:2018 (3d Edition) in the UAE till the end of the transition period.
However, the transition period ends on December 20, 2021. After that date, only the 3rd Edition of the IEC 62368 will remain valid. It means that ECAS/EQM certificates of conformity issued against IEC 62368-1:2014 requirements will become invalid despite the expiration date. Thus, to be able to circulate on the UAE market, the products must have ECAS/EQM certificates of conformity that show the compliance of the product with IEC 62368-1:2018 requirements.
